zgkhoo Posted October 29, 2007 Share Posted October 29, 2007 if(isset($_POST['confirm'])){ //echo "row".$_SESSION["numrows"]; $curr_crd=$_SESSION["serial"]; mysql_query("DELETE FROM gamecard WHERE serialnum = '$curr_crd'"); session_destroy(); //exit; header('Location: displaydelcard.php'); } with the above delete code, when i delete a record...which this record is the middle of the a group of record, then deleted row in the table become "Blank" which the bellow row/record wont fill in, after that i store another record, then it stored in the middle of the table(the deleted record's row/position), wat i wan is the new record appear in the last row of the table, anyone know how to solve it? thanks.. Quote Link to comment Share on other sites More sharing options...
fenway Posted October 29, 2007 Share Posted October 29, 2007 If you're talking about the UID, then there is nothing to solve. Leave the UID to the database, and sort your results by something meaningful. Quote Link to comment Share on other sites More sharing options...
zgkhoo Posted October 29, 2007 Author Share Posted October 29, 2007 UID? wats that? mysql wont also organize by move all the bellow record one step to the upper? thanks.. Quote Link to comment Share on other sites More sharing options...
fenway Posted October 29, 2007 Share Posted October 29, 2007 The "middle" doesn't exist. Quote Link to comment Share on other sites More sharing options...
zgkhoo Posted October 29, 2007 Author Share Posted October 29, 2007 huh? wat meant? i just view it by mysql query browser..it show that. thanks Quote Link to comment Share on other sites More sharing options...
fenway Posted October 29, 2007 Share Posted October 29, 2007 huh? wat meant? i just view it by mysql query browser..it show that. thanks Then add an appropriate order by clause.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.